6. Positioning the Dispersion Tool in the Fluid

The dispersion tool, with the drive unit and the vessel retainer, can be positioned correctly by
loosening the knurled screws 1 and 2 (F and H) on the sleeve coupling and moving the retainer
rod. Retighten the knurled screws 1 and 2 (F and H) on the sleeve coupling (E).

7. Operating under Pressure or in a Vacuum with the Sealed Dispersion Tool

When operating under pressure or in a vacuum with the sealed tool, always posi-
tion the stator shaft in the fluid so that the upper hole (TT) in the stator shaft is
always above the level of the fluid.
If the hole (TT) is below the level of the fluid, fluid can enter the upper area of the
dispersion tool due to the change in pressure conditions and damage it.

8. Connecting the Power Supply (unit) (S)

Connect the Power Supply (unit) (S) to the drive unit (U) with the small plug (T).


Connect the power connection cable (V) to the receptacle (X) with the plug (W). Place the
switch (Y) in the “0” position and turn the knob (Z) all the way to the left stop.
